Sand molding machines are essential equipment in foundries, used to create molds for metal casting. These machines automate the process of compacting sand around a pattern, ensuring consistent mold quality and reducing manual labor. There are various types of sand molding machines, including jolt-squeeze, blow-squeeze, and matchplate machines, each suited for specific applications.
The working principle of a sand molding machine involves filling a flask with prepared sand, compacting it around the pattern, and then ejecting the finished mold. Advanced machines may incorporate features like automatic pattern changes, real-time monitoring, and energy-efficient designs. The choice of machine depends on factors such as production volume, mold complexity, and the type of metal being cast.

Maintenance of sand molding machines is critical to ensure longevity and performance. Regular lubrication, inspection of hydraulic systems, and cleaning of sand residues are necessary to prevent downtime. Operators should also be trained in safety protocols to avoid accidents related to moving parts or high-pressure systems.
